Tirana, the capital of Albania, was a mix of old and new buildings with plenty of communist-era architecture. The highlight of my visit was the Pyramid, a former museum turned into a community center, covered in street art. I also visited the Blloku area, once reserved for high-ranking officials, now a trendy spot filled with cafes and shops. I learned that Albania went through a revolution in 1991 to overthrow the communist government and embrace democracy. The people I met were friendly and proud of their country's progress. Overall, Tirana was an exciting and unique destination.
